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Sandbox based script updating method and system

An update method and script technology, applied in the sandbox-based script update method and system field, can solve problems such as user time and economic loss, and achieve the effect of improving user experience and reducing update costs

Inactive Publication Date: 2014-10-22
SUZHOU METIS INFORMATION TECH
View PDF0 Cites 10 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] However, usually many customers' businesses require 24-hour uninterrupted operation. When the program is updated, once the service is stopped for users, it will bring time and economic losses to users.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Sandbox based script updating method and system
  • Sandbox based script updating method and system
  • Sandbox based script updating method and system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0052] The following will clearly and completely describe the technical solutions in the embodiments of the present invention with reference to the accompanying drawings in the embodiments of the present invention. Obviously, the described embodiments are only some, not all, embodiments of the present invention. Based on the embodiments of the present invention, all other embodiments obtained by persons of ordinary skill in the art without making creative efforts belong to the protection scope of the present invention.

[0053] In order to make the above objects, features and advantages of the present invention more comprehensible, the present invention will be further described in detail below in conjunction with the accompanying drawings and specific embodiments.

[0054] The inventor has found through research that script managers and virtual machines are embedded in most programs (such as java programs). The process of running the program is also the process of executing t...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a sandbox based script updating method and system. The sandbox based script updating method includes steps of storing data structures generated during script loading into a sandbox; storing running data by citing the data structures in the sandbox during running of scripts; judging whether the scripts need to be updated or not to obtain judgment results; when the judgment results indicate that the scripts need to be updated, unloading the scripts in a virtual machine; rewriting the updated scripts into the virtual machine; citing the running data from the sandbox as local variables for returning to serve. By the sandbox based script updating method and system, program running is not interrupted while the programs can be updated, updating cost of the programs is reduced, and user experience is improved.

Description

technical field [0001] The invention relates to the field of program development, in particular to a sandbox-based script updating method and system. Background technique [0002] With the development of information technology, more and more users implement business operations through computer programs. When the needs of users change, the functions of the program also need to be adjusted accordingly. Such adjustments to program functions may be referred to as program updates. [0003] In the prior art, the method for updating the program is mainly to recompile the entire program first, and then test after a long period of compilation to ensure that the test is correct before releasing the updated program. During the whole process, the service to users needs to be stopped. [0004] However, usually many customers' businesses require 24-hour uninterrupted operation. When the program is updated, once the service to users is stopped, it will bring time and economic losses to u...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/445G06F9/455
Inventor 郭铁志张宝玉马向晖
Owner SUZHOU METIS INFORMATION T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products